We will use Johnson’s rule to sequence the jobs. The Johnson’s rule steps from the text are shown
below:
1. Select the job with the shortest time. If the shortest time is at the first work center, schedule
2. Eliminate the job and its time from further consideration.
3. Repeat steps 1 and 2, working toward the center of the sequence, until all jobs have been
scheduled.
(a) Order C has the shortest time (0.80). Because the time is at Step 2, schedule Order C last
(7th). Eliminate Order C from further consideration.
